    The Musée du Champignon, located in the picturesque town of Saumur, is a delightful destination that celebrates the fascinating world of mushrooms. This unique museum showcases an impressive collection of over 1,000 species of fungi, making it one of the most comprehensive mushroom exhibits in France. Visitors will be captivated by the intricate beauty and diversity of mushrooms displayed in a series of informative and engaging exhibits. The museum offers a perfect blend of education and entertainment, making it an ideal stop for families, nature enthusiasts, and anyone curious about the wonders of the fungal kingdom. As you wander through the museum, you'll discover the ecological importance of mushrooms, their various uses in culinary arts, medicine, and their role in biodiversity. The exhibits are designed to be interactive, providing visitors with hands-on experiences that enhance learning and appreciation for these remarkable organisms.
